On the 9th June 2012 Richard Ford suffered a massive and unexpected brain stem stroke whilst at home with his wife and 3 young sons.
Richard was a skilled Detective Constable, junior football coach, marathon runner and a fabulous Husband and Daddy.
With his brain starved of oxygen for 8 hours, this stroke has left Richard dependant on nursing for his every need and daily care.
Richard does however have stammina, determination and a will to get better and return home to his family.
He is making small, slow, encouraging steps on his long, arduous road to recovery.
The trust has been set up as an ongoing fundraiser. It is hoped that with the generous donations given, that Richard's future rehabillitation and recovery costs once he leaves hospital will be eased.
